Nestled in the heart of the enchanting town of Ravello, this country home on Via Torello offers a unique opportunity to craft your dream second home on the iconic Amalfi Coast. With its rich history, breathtaking vistas, and vibrant cultural scene, Ravello is a jewel in Italy's crown, making it an ideal location for those seeking a serene yet culturally rich retreat.
Imagine waking up to the gentle rustle of olive trees and the distant hum of the Mediterranean Sea. This property, though in need of renovation, is a canvas waiting for your personal touch. Built around 1940, the rustic charm of the house is evident in its stone walls and traditional architecture, offering a glimpse into the past while providing a foundation for a modern, personalized haven.
A Blank Canvas with Endless Potential
The property comprises two small adjacent buildings, offering a total indoor living area of approximately 30 square meters. The layout includes a bedroom and a habitable kitchen, perfect for creating a cozy and functional living space. The absence of bathrooms presents an opportunity to design a bespoke bathing area that complements your vision.

The Allure of Ravello
Ravello is renowned for its breathtaking views, historic villas, and vibrant cultural scene, including the famous Ravello Festival. Perched high above the Amalfi Coast, the town offers panoramic vistas of the Mediterranean Sea and the surrounding mountains. Living here means being part of a community that values tradition, beauty, and a slower pace of life.
